Subject: latest -git: hibernate: possible circular locking dependency detected

Hi,

I just got this on v2.6.27-rc4 (+ unrelated fix):

ACPI: Preparing to enter system sleep state S5
=======================================================
[ INFO: possible circular locking dependency detected ]
2.6.27-rc4-00003-ga798564 #28
-------------------------------------------------------
events/0/10 is trying to acquire lock:
 (cpu_add_remove_lock){--..}, at: [<c013bd9f>] cpu_maps_update_begin+0xf/0x20
but task is already holding lock:
 (poweroff_work){--..}, at: [<c014ae17>] run_workqueue+0x107/0x200
which lock already depends on the new lock.
the existing dependency chain (in reverse order) is:

...the machine would shut down, but not resume:

Trying to resume from /dev/VolGroup00/LogVol01
No suspend signature on swap, not resuming.
Creating root device.
Mounting root filesystem.

I previously also saw some SLUB errors on resuming (but those didn't
make it to the serial console, unfortunately); will post follow-up if
I can manage to get a capture.

I don't know if it's related, but I was reading some files from /sys
while doing the "echo disk > /sys/power/state".
